Blogging Via Phone – Practical

An upgrade to the iPhone client for my blogging software has made it not only easier to blog via phone, but actually practical. For example, this entry was created on my iPhone. Many people wonder if perhaps we are in the post PC era, but I am wondering, do we even need a tablet like the iPad? I can actually type about as fast on the iPhone as I do on the iPad, and maybe a little faster. After all there is less travel on the keyboard. I just have to hold the phone sideways. I have also found that reading books on the iPhone is much better than I would have guessed and my hands and arms don’t get as tired. There are many things I use the iPad for still, but the iPhone has come to surprise me.
